Adjusting the telescopic height (Fig. E-1, E-2)
• Unlock the lever (5) to release the telescopic
handle (7).
• Extend or retract the telescopic handle (7) to
the desired length.
• Secure the telescopic handle by locking the
lever (5).
Adjusting the pivoting hedge trimmer head
(Fig. F-1, F-2)
• Press both the button (2) on the side of the
hedge trimmer head (1).
• Adjust the head to the desired position.
• Release the button (2) and make sure the head
is locked in place.
4. OPERATION
Before use (Fig. G)
Remove the blade guard (11) and lubricate the
blades (4).
Switching on and off
Always hold the hedge trimmer with both hands.
Place one hand on the telescopic handle (7) and
one hand on the rear handle near the power switch.
Press and hold the power switch (6) to operate the
machine. When the power switch is released the
machine will automatically stop.
After use
Wipe off any dirt and debris from the blades (4)
using a brush or cloth. Lubricate the blades, place
the blade guard (11), and remove the battery (12)
before storing the machine.
5. MAINTENANCE
Before cleaning and maintenance, always
switch off the machine and remove the
battery pack from the machine.
Clean the machine casings regularly with a soft
cloth, preferably after each use. Make sure that
the ventilation openings are free of dust and dirt.
12
Remove very persistent dirt using a soft cloth mois-
tened with soapsuds. Do not use any solvents such
as gasoline, alcohol, ammonia, etc. Chemicals such
as these will damage the synthetic components.
Cutting blade
• Always wear gloves when handling or cleaning
the cutting blade.
• Clean the cutting blade and spray with a
protective oil after every use. We recommend
lubricating the cutting blade with protective oil
at regular intervals during long working periods.
• Visually inspect the condition of the cutting
blade. Check if the screws are fi rmly seated in
the cutter bar.
Storage
The hedge trimmer should be kept in a safe, dry
place, well out of the reach of children. Do not
place other objects on top of it.
